… подход предполагает построение программного обеспечения из отдельных компонентов – физически отдельно существующих частей программного обеспечения, которые взаимодействуют между собой через стандартизированные двоичные интерфейсы.
Другие предметы Университет Компонентный Технология программирования программное обеспечение компоненты стандартизированные интерфейсы университетский курс структурное программирование функциональное программирование компонентный подход взаимодействие компонентов Новый
В данном вопросе речь идет о подходе к разработке программного обеспечения, который предполагает использование отдельных компонентов. Давайте разберем, что это значит и какие подходы могут быть связаны с этим понятием.
1. Компонентный подход
Компонентный подход в разработке программного обеспечения подразумевает, что программа состоит из независимых модулей или компонентов. Каждый компонент выполняет конкретную функцию и может быть разработан, протестирован и внедрен отдельно от других компонентов. Это позволяет:
2. Стандартизированные интерфейсы
Компоненты взаимодействуют друг с другом через стандартизированные интерфейсы. Это означает, что каждый компонент имеет четко определенные входные и выходные параметры, по которым он может обмениваться данными с другими компонентами. Такой подход позволяет:
3. Примеры компонентного подхода
Существует множество технологий и фреймворков, которые поддерживают компонентный подход. Например:
4. Заключение
Таким образом, компонентный подход является мощным инструментом в разработке программного обеспечения, позволяющим создавать гибкие и легко поддерживаемые приложения. Этот подход особенно актуален в условиях быстрого изменения технологий и потребностей пользователей.